תַּאֲרֵעַ

ta.a.re.aProper Noun (Masculine)H8390

Tarea

From: perhaps from H772 (אֲרַע);

Short Definition

Taarea, an Israelite

Full Lexicon Entry

A man of the tribe of Benjamin living at the time of United Monarchy, first mentioned at ; son of: Micah (H4318H); brother of: Pithon (H6377), Melech (H4429) and Ahaz (H0271H); also called Tahrea at ; Also named: tach.re.a (*תַּחֲרֵעַ *"Tahrea" H8475) § Tarea = "chamber of a neighbour" a Benjamite, son of Micah of the family of Saul
